[Use of the test with disodium salt of 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id for diagnosis of latent forms of hypoparathyroidism]

Abstract
A test with disodium salt of 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id was conducted in 29 individuals--9 healthy ones, 5 patients with latent hypoparathyroidism, 7 with manifest hypoparathyroidism given vitamin D 2, and 8 patients who sustained an operation on the thyroid gland. Primary reduction of the calcium level in patients with latent hypoparathyroidism was in 12 hours combined with a low calcium level, not exceeding 8.5% mg. Along with this in the mentioned group of patients, and also in the patients operated for goiter and in some of the patients given vitamin D 2 there were observed peculiarities of the calciemic curves during the first hours of the test differentiating them from the normal. The diagnostic significance of this is discussed.
